找回密码
 注册

QQ登录

只需一步,快速开始

扫一扫,访问微社区

巢课
电巢直播8月计划

proteus仿真 不准确

查看数: 208 | 评论数: 2 | 收藏 0
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2015-8-26 11:47

正文摘要:

我是利用定时器来进行仿真的 下面是我的程序 我打算输出1US的方波但是结果却是40us 2 W9 V1 ^: r! y; E#include<reg51.h> 3 a* G% c( W; z5 a. R4 b  E0 k#define uint unsigned int 9 s" K6 e3 H) ...

回复

Aiby2015 发表于 2015-8-27 22:43
ArthurGXH 发表于 2015-8-27 17:005 b) |6 ^- }( X' x1 }, h! F. w
1. proteus仿真,我没有使用过。经过分析,问题可能出在你的身上。你用的是12M晶振、12时钟吧。你用定时器 ...
+ d* v/ v) \+ u1 K) n4 l! y1 U
恩 我后面也发现是我的问题。。谢谢
" k) k6 m9 a0 m3 X) M+ q) r( M
ArthurGXH 发表于 2015-8-27 17:00
1. proteus仿真,我没有使用过。经过分析,问题可能出在你的身上。你用的是12M晶振、12时钟吧。你用定时器定1us,实际单片机在这么短的时间内,只够执行1条指令。你的中断里写了多少条指令啊?若不信,你把定时改成60us试试,肯定准确。& O' I; h% W0 a& Z
2. 遇到问题,尽量不要先怀疑仿真器的问题,一般仿真器出问题的概率是比较小的。经验之谈。

点评

恩 我后面也发现是我的问题。。谢谢  详情 回复 发表于 2015-8-27 22:43
关闭

推荐内容上一条 /1 下一条

巢课

技术风云榜

关于我们|手机版|EDA365 ( 粤ICP备18020198号 )

GMT+8, 2024-11-15 17:44 , Processed in 0.059240 second(s), 37 queries , Gzip On.

深圳市墨知创新科技有限公司

地址:深圳市南山区科技生态园2栋A座805 电话:19926409050

快速回复 返回顶部 返回列表